Why Traditional Systems Fall Short for Investment Analytics
Traditional approaches in investment analytics often hinge on legacy ETL pipelines and monolithic systems that isolate data from ecommerce and social commerce touchpoints. This setup creates several pain points:
- Data latency leads to delays in actionable insights.
- Lack of unified data sources results in fragmented views of customer behaviors.
- Experimentation is hindered because data is not agile or flexible enough for rapid testing.
For example, in one analytics platform firm, conversion rates stagnated around 3.2% because reports were batch-run daily, making it impossible to respond to fast-moving market shifts or social commerce trends. The root cause was a lack of integration between ecommerce platforms, social commerce data, and investment decision engines.
Practical Steps Senior Ecommerce Management Should Take
1. Prioritize Real-Time Data Pipelines Across Social Commerce and Ecommerce
The data landscape in investment analytics is evolving, especially with the rise of social commerce platforms that influence purchasing behavior and market sentiment. Integrating social commerce data streams with traditional ecommerce analytics requires streaming architectures rather than batch ETL.
Implement event-driven data ingestion to pull insights directly from social commerce interactions, such as influencer campaigns or peer-to-peer recommendations, alongside ecommerce transactions. This enables real-time experimentation and evidence-based tweaks to investment strategies.
2. Adopt a Modular Architecture with Clear Data Ownership
A modular system integration architecture reduces silos by breaking down analytics platforms into discrete services with defined data ownership—critical for large investment firms where compliance and audit trails are non-negotiable.
Modules might include:
- Ecommerce transaction processing
- Social commerce engagement analytics
- Portfolio performance tracking
This separation with standardized APIs allows for independent scaling and faster troubleshooting when anomalies occur, enhancing confidence in data-driven decisions.
3. Use Experimentation Frameworks Integrated with Analytics for Evidence-Based Decisions
Experimentation is essential for validating hypotheses about customer behavior or market reactions. However, experimentation requires tight integration between control and treatment groups' data and investment outcome metrics.
Leverage tools like Zigpoll for real-time customer feedback combined with internal experimentation frameworks to measure the impact of tweaks on conversion and retention. One analytics platform team saw an 8% lift in engagement when they integrated a social commerce feedback loop into their experimentation process, allowing rapid iteration.
4. Embed Data Quality and Governance Controls into Integration Layers
Bad data is the enemy of sound investment decisions. Traditional architectures often bolt on data quality checks after ingestion, costing valuable time and increasing error risks.
Embed data validation, anomaly detection, and lineage tracking directly within integration layers. This approach ensures that senior ecommerce managers rely on clean, trusted data when assessing investment opportunities, reducing costly missteps.

system integration architecture software comparison for investment?
Choosing the right integration software depends on scale and flexibility needs. Common contenders include:
| Software | Strengths | Weaknesses |
|---|---|---|
| Apache Kafka | High-throughput, real-time data | Requires specialist skills |
| MuleSoft | API-led, good for modular design | Can be expensive |
| Talend | Strong data quality features | Batch-oriented by default |
| Fivetran | Easy SaaS integration | Limited real-time capabilities |
Investment firms often combine Kafka for real-time processing with Talend or Fivetran for batch ingestion and data quality, balancing cost and performance.

What Can Go Wrong and How to Mitigate Risks
Integration complexity can introduce new failure points. Poorly managed APIs may cause data loss or misalignment. Avoid this through rigorous testing, incremental rollouts, and comprehensive monitoring.
Overemphasis on real-time can also backfire if data quality suffers in the rush to reduce latency. Balance speed with accuracy by embedding governance controls as a non-negotiable foundation.
For social commerce data, beware of overfitting models to hype signals without sufficient volume or validation. Testing against historical baselines helps mitigate this risk.
